Snížení ceny se stala stále populárnější pro psaní obsahu online díky své jednoduchosti a přímočarému stylu. Jak jeho popularita stoupá, často se používá jako značkovací jazyk pro online dokumentaci, soubory readme a dokonce i plnohodnotné znalostní báze. Nicméně, jakkoli je tento lehký značkovací jazyk flexibilní a agilní, přichází s vlastní řadou výzev, jako je správa prázdných řádků nebo zajištění toho, aby obsah vypadal jasně a čitelně. Tento tutoriál se ponoří do těchto zvláštností a zaměří se především na to, jak se vypořádat se scénáři, kdy je v dokumentu Markdown vyžadován prázdný řádek.
Správa a vkládání prázdných řádků do souborů Markdown může být matoucí, protože Markdown interpretuje dva po sobě jdoucí řádky jako začátek nového odstavce a jeden nový řádek jako pokračování stávajícího řádku. Řešení vkládání prázdných řádků je jednoduché a efektivní a zahrnuje použití HTML `
` ve vašem souboru Markdown.
printf("<br/>");
Výše uvedený úryvek při použití v souboru markdown generuje prázdný řádek. '
Značka ` v podstatě označuje zalomení řádku.
Mechanika Markdownu
Markdown vám umožňuje psát pomocí snadno čitelného a snadno zapisovatelného formátu prostého textu. Podporuje však HTML. To znamená, že můžete použít značky HTML, jako je `
` ve vašem souboru Markdown pro vylepšení formátování. Právě tato funkce nám umožňuje řešit potřebu prázdného řádku.
Nezapomeňte použít `
` označte opatrně markdownem. I když je to užitečný nástroj, časté používání může nafouknout vaše soubory a pracovat proti klíčové výhodě Markdown – jednoduchosti a čitelnosti.
Role knihoven nebo funkcí
V programování C existují specifické knihovny a funkce, které mohou pomoci přidat HTML tagy do souborů Markdown.
Například, stdio.h je standardní vstupní/výstupní knihovna v programování C. Často se používá k zahrnutí funkcí pro úlohy, jako je `printf()`, `scanf()` atd. Pokud tedy pracujeme s programem v jazyce C, který generuje soubor Markdown, zahrnuli byste soubor `stdio.h ` knihovna pro usnadnění zápisu do tohoto souboru Markdown.
#include <stdio.h> int main() { FILE *fp; fp = fopen("test.md", "w+"); fprintf(fp, "<br/>"); fclose(fp); return 0; }
Výše uvedený kód ilustruje, jak používat knihovnu a funkci k vložení zalomení řádku do souboru markdown.
Shrnutí
Manipulace s prázdnými řádky v Markdown pomocí HTML kódu vám v podstatě dává větší kontrolu nad strukturou textu a celkovou organizací vašeho dokumentu. Z pohledu SEO je pro dobré hodnocení rozhodující čitelnost a struktura textu, a proto moudrá správa prázdných řádků zvyšuje kvalitu obsahu. Z pohledu uživatelů jasný a dobře strukturovaný obsah zlepšuje porozumění. Zvládnutí markdownových nuancí tedy také zlepšuje zkušenost koncového uživatele.